Ever wonder what Reservoir Dogs would have been like with an all-female cast? No? Well Mr Blonde and Mr Orange did - in a 1993 interview with Film Threat, Tim Roth mused that Tarantino could have made "one of the most controversial films ever made by just reversing the roles", a hypothetical production Michael Madsen called "Reservoir Bitches". Twelve years later, a group of Toronto comediennes and actresses have picked up that gauntlet. The production......
